Is Manassas, VA a Good Place to Live?

Manassas is a small city of 42,620 in Virginia, with a median household income of $110,559 and a 3.3% unemployment rate. Its cost of living index is 109 (US average = 100), which is 9% above the national average.

Strengths: Manassas stands out for lower-than-average crime, solid school ratings (B-).

Cost of Living

Index: 108.6

Manassas's overall cost of living index is 108.6, where 100 represents the US national average. Living in Manassas costs roughly 9% more than the average American city.

Metric Manassas, VA National Avg
Median Home Value $393,900 $244,900
Median Monthly Rent $1,784 $1,163
Homeownership Rate 74.0% 65.9%
Median Household Income $110,559 $74,755

Crime & Safety

Safer than Average

Manassas's violent crime rate is 274.2 per 100,000 residents — 28% lower than the national average of ~380 per 100,000.

Schools & Education

Manassas is served primarily by Manassas City Public Schools. The student-to-teacher ratio is 16.1:1 (slightly above the national average of ~16:1).

Metric Manassas, VA National Avg
School District Manassas City Public Schools
Elementary Schools 5
Middle Schools 3
High Schools 1
Student/Teacher Ratio 16.1:1 16:1
Bachelor's Degree or Higher 34.5% 35.4%
High School Diploma or Higher 85.8% 91.1%

Weather & Climate

Manassas sees average highs of 42.4°F in January and 87.5°F in July, with 47.6 inches of annual precipitation and 21.0 inches of snow per year.
